This issue of Clarkesworld Magazine presents seven original science fiction stories alongside critical essays and interviews. Rich Larson contributes "The Ghost Ship Anastasia," while Vina Jie-Min Prasad explores identity in "A Series of Steaks." Lettie Prell examines parallel realities in "Justice Systems in Quantum Parallel Probabilities," and Gary Kloster offers "Interchange." Lorenzo Crescentini and Emanuela Valentini provide "Milla" in Rich Larson's translation. John Kessel delivers "Events Preceding the Helvetican Renaissance," and Aliette de Bodard rounds out the fiction with "The Shipmaker." The nonfiction section includes Benjamin C. Kinney's examination of consciousness in "The Evolved Brain" and Chris Urie's conversation with James S.A. Corey about collaborative writing. Kelly Robson discusses genre limitations in "Another Word: Dystopias Are Not Enough," while editor Neil Clarke reflects on the magazine's direction.
